What Does the “Maintenance Required” Light in Your Car Mean?

January 10, 2025 by Adekiya Joscor

Toyota Camry dashboard showing maintenance required light on the screen.

You’re cruising along, and suddenly, a light on your dashboard pops up: “Maintenance Required.“ What does it mean? Should you pull over? Relax, it’s not as dire as it seems. Let’s break it down.

The Purpose of the Maintenance Required Light

This light is a friendly reminder, not a cause for panic. Its job is to nudge you toward routine vehicle maintenance. Here’s what you need to know:

  • Routine Maintenance Alert: Most manufacturers set this light to activate every 4,500-5,000 miles. It’s a cue for things like oil changes, filter replacements, and tire rotations.
  • Not an Emergency Warning: Unlike the Check Engine light, which signals a potential malfunction, this one simply reminds you that regular upkeep is due. Think of it as your car saying, “Hey, time for a check-up!”

Why Does the Light Come On?

Several reasons might trigger the Maintenance Required light:

1. Oil and Filter Changes

  • Your engine’s oil needs regular replacement to stay lubricated and prevent wear. Skipping oil changes can lead to costly repairs.

2. Fluid Checks

  • Coolant, brake fluid, and windshield washer fluid levels might be low. Regular checks keep your car running smoothly.

3. Mileage-Based Reminders

  • Many vehicles are programmed to activate the light after a certain number of miles, ensuring you stay on top of maintenance.

What to Do When the Light Turns On

Seeing this light doesn’t mean you need to rush to a mechanic, but it’s a good idea to act sooner rather than later. Here’s a quick action plan:

  1. Check Your Maintenance Schedule: Your owner’s manual will outline what services are due.
  2. Perform Routine Maintenance: If it’s been a while since your last oil change or inspection, schedule one soon.
  3. Reset the Light: Once maintenance is complete, the light needs resetting. This is often done using your car’s onboard menu or by a mechanic.

Why Ignoring It Is a Bad Idea

It’s tempting to ignore dashboard lights, especially when your car seems fine. But here’s why you shouldn’t:

  • Increased Wear and Tear: Neglecting maintenance accelerates wear on your engine and other systems.
  • Costly Repairs: Small issues caught early are cheaper to fix. Ignoring them often leads to bigger, more expensive problems.
  • Reduced Resale Value: Regular maintenance records boost your car’s value when it’s time to sell.

FAQs About the Maintenance Required Light

1. Is it safe to keep driving with the light on?

Yes, for a short period. But schedule maintenance soon to avoid long-term issues.

2. Can I reset the light myself?

Often, yes! Check your car’s manual for instructions. If unsure, a mechanic can do it for you.

3. How much does routine maintenance cost?

Basic services like oil changes typically range from $50-$150, depending on your car and location.

4. Does the light mean something is broken?

No, it’s a reminder for scheduled maintenance, not a sign of immediate trouble.

5. Can I ignore the light if my car runs fine?

You could, but skipping maintenance risks more expensive repairs later. It’s better to stay proactive.
